GLA UNIVERSITY - HISTORY AND CAMPUS


It was in the year 1998 that Shri Narayan Das Agrawal took the initiative to fulfill his fathers dream and laid down the foundation of the GLA Group of Institutions that later grew to become the GLA University through the U.P. State Legislative Act of 2009 (UP Act 21 of 2010). The Campus of the University is spread across more than 80 acres of lush green and expansive grounds. The University is home to more than 6,000 students, studying in a gamut of professional courses. The establishment feels proud of its alumni base of more than 9500 students. The University premises are one of the best in the region and give the University, an advantage over its compatriots. The campus with modern infrastructural facilities deserves a mention for its well designed and maintained buildings, contemporary laboratories, spacious residential complexes, and recreational facilities. The University employs more than 350 qualified faculty and 500 staff members. Renowned academicians, who believe in the over-all growth and development of their students, head the institutions of GLA University. SALIENT FEATURES
The 80+ acres campus is now a home away from home for more than 4,000 students with impressive hostel & mess facilities. Air-conditioned & aesthetic class rooms and conference halls creating ideal learning environment. Along with one central library each institute and department has separate library. The central library has more than hundred thousands books, journals, magazines, newspapers, encyclopedia & thousands of CDs. With the membership of DELNET, University now has access to 83,69,299 bibliographic records, 33,541 periodicals along with a huge range of CD ROMs and e-books. The GLA Community today is globally connected through internet by 1Gbps gold line of NMEICT and Airtel computing facilities which are provided on more than 1200 computers, systematically organized in 9 computer centres. Online lectures of IIT professors on LAN through NPTEL. Fun learning through Classle Classes. Transportation and Ambulance facilities. Indias first Mission 10Xs Technology Learning Centre by WIPRO. Campus Connect Program by Infosys. Centre of Excellence by IBM. Faculty from IlTs, NITs and other prestigious Institutions.

RESIDENTIAL FACILITIES
Separate hostels for boys & girls. Mess Facilities serves nutritious food prepared in hygienic condition. A Team of four full-time well qualified resident doctors, along with two part-time specialists are always ready to serve round-the-clock as the need requires. The team is supported by well-equipped dispensary and ambulance facilities. A cafeteria & canteen serves cuisines of various tastes. The University houses a departmental store, which stocks the basic daily need items. A full-fledges Bank branch along with ATM facility is available on campus. Students Welfare Cell. Round-the-clock electricity and water supply. Air-conditioned reading room in the library opens till midnight.

TRAINING & PLACEMENT


Excellent track record of more than 70% placement every year
The Department of Training and Placement is an integral part of the University. Training activities are organized throughout the year in an effort towards preparing the prospective students for the campus selection programmes. Eminent professors and professionals organize regular training workshops to develop leadership skills in students. The department aims at achieving hundred percent placements every year with the support of highly reputed academicians belonging to various professional fields across the globe. The department focuses on placing the students in various establishments according to their area of interest and specialization. This is achieved by helping them acquire some work experience as a part of their curriculum with the help of summer training programmes and projects. Numerous corporate interactions in the form of guest lectures and industrial visits enable the students to get acquainted with the real-life occupational situations. These industrial visits are crucial for understanding the culture of the industrial world. More than 140 companies visit every year for students placement. In the year 2013 again 70 percent students have been placed in 129 companies.
